1. What are wire wound resistors?

Wire wound resistors are passive electronic components with a conductive wire wrapped around an insulating core. The wire is usually made of a resistive material, such as nichrome or constantan, which has high resistance to current flow. These resistors can be designed for different power ratings, resistance values, and tolerances to suit specific circuit requirements.

2. How are wire wound resistors used in the Philippines?

Wire wound resistors find applications in a wide range of industries within the Philippines. From consumer electronics to power distribution and industrial automation, wire wound resistors are used to control current flow in circuits, limit excessive power dissipation, and ensure the proper functioning of electronic devices.

In consumer electronics, wire wound resistors are commonly found in televisions, audio equipment, and computers. They help regulate current to prevent damage to sensitive components and ensure safe, reliable operation.

In the power generation and distribution sector, wire wound resistors are utilized in load banks, surge protection devices, and voltage dividers. These resistors help manage power flows, protect equipment from overloads, and maintain stable electrical systems.

Industrial automation heavily relies on wire wound resistors for motor control, motor braking, and power transmission. The resistors enable precise and controlled operations, ensuring efficient manufacturing processes and safe machinery operation.

3. What makes wire wound resistors important in the Philippines?

Wire wound resistors play a vital role in various fields within the Philippines due to several key factors:

Precision and Accuracy: Wire wound resistors offer a high level of precision and accuracy in controlling current flow. This is crucial in sensitive electronic equipment to avoid component damage and ensure proper functionality.

Reliability and Durability: Wire wound resistors are known for their robustness and durability. They can handle high power and voltage ratings, making them reliable components in demanding applications. Their ability to dissipate heat efficiently also helps prevent overheating and potential component failure.

Stability: Wire wound resistors exhibit excellent stability over time, making them ideal for critical applications where precise resistance values need to be maintained consistently.
